The Hartford Convention was a series of meetings in 1814 where New England Federalists discussed their opposition to the War of 1812, but no single author can be attributed to it as it was a collaborative effort among the delegates from various states like Massachusetts, Connecticut, and Rhode Island. The Convention produced a list of proposed amendments to the U.S. Constitution, including limits on embargoes and a requirement for a two-thirds majority in Congress to declare war.

The Federalist party-dominated Hartford Convention of December 1814 issued a report that attacked the War of 1812 as ineffective and oppressive, and made recommenations to limit the power of the federal government.
